Elec 326 1 sequential circuit design sequential circuit design objectives this section deals with the design of sequential circuits including the following. A synchronous sequential circuit contains exactly 1 clock signal. In synchronous circuits the input are pulses or levels and pulses with certain restrictions on pulse width and circuit propagation delay. Circuit,g, state diagram, state table circuits with flipflop sequential circuit circuit state diagram state table state minimizationstate minimization. All sequential circuits contain combinational logic in addition to the memory elements. A familiar example of a device with sequential logic is a television set. Sequential logic sequential circuits simple circuits with feedback latches edgetriggered flipflops timing methodologies cascading flipflops for proper operation clock skew asynchronous inputs metastability and synchronization basic registers shift registers simple. Ripple counter increased delay as in ripplecarry adders delay proportional to the number of bits. Ffs controlled by a clock operate in pulse mode asynchronous sequential circuits do not operate in synchronous with clock signal.
Sequential circuit analysis university of pittsburgh. Useful for storing binary information and for the design of asynchronous sequential circuits. Sequential logic is used to construct finite state machines, a basic building block in all digital circuitry. Combinational digital circuits and sequential digital circuits. However, the purpose is not to turn the students into circuit designers, but to give them an idea of how sequential circuits work. In this course material we design and analyze only synchronous sequential logic. Especially true given a flow tables that might have. Grading for reference, here is a short explanation of the grading criteria. Elec 326 1 sequential circuit analysis sequential circuit analysis objectives this section introduces synchronous sequential circuits with the following goals.
The block diagram of the sequential circuit as shown below. Avoid to use latches as possible in synchronous sequential circuits to. Asynchronous sequential circuits asynchronous sequential circuits have state that is not synchronized with a clock. Digital electronics part i combinational and sequential logic. Oct 26, 2012 sequential circuits outputs depend on present inputs and previous inputs also it contains memory elements for storing previous state inputs examples of sequential circuits are flip flops, counters, shift registers 4. Sequential logic sequential circuits simple circuits with feedback latches edgetriggered flipflops timing methodologies cascading flipflops for proper operation clock skew asynchronous inputs metastability and synchronization basic registers shift registers simple counters hardware description languages and sequential logic. Analysis procedure asynchronous sequential circuits the analysis of asynchronous sequential circuits proceeds in much the same way as that of clocked synchronous sequential circuits. This type of circuits uses previous input, output, clock and a memory element. From a logic diagram, boolean expressions are written and then transferred into tabular form.
Combinational circuits are the class of digital circuits where the outputs of the circuit are dependent only on the current inputs. Reasonable to assume that it might be possible to combine merge multiple states into a single state just like in synchronous sequential circuits. Asynchronous asynchronous sequential circuits internal states can change at any. Our pdf merger allows you to quickly combine multiple pdf files into one single pdf document, in just a few clicks. Virtually all circuits in practical digital devices are a mixture of combinational and sequential logic. Therefore synchronous circuits can be divided into clocked sequential circuits and uncklocked or pulsed. But sequential circuit has memory so output can vary based on input.
Introduce several structural and behavioral models for synchronous sequential circuits. Input signals change one at a time and only when the circuit is in the stable state. The behavior of a clocked sequential circuit is determined from its inputs, outputs. Introduce several structural and behavioral models for.
In 1978, sequential released the prophet5, the first programmable polyphonic synthesizer, used by artists including michael jackson, madonna, and john carpenter. Block diagram flip flop flip flop is a sequential circuit which generally samples its. Chapter 5 synchronous sequential logic 51 sequential circuits every digital system is likely to have combinational circuits, most systems encountered in practice also include storage elements, which require that the system be described in term of sequential logic. Sample of the study material part of chapter 5 combinational. Basically, sequential circuits have memory and combinational circuits do not. Define the following global timing parameters and show how they can be derived from the basic timing parameters. Sequential circuits that are not synchronized by a clock. Pdf merge combinejoin pdf files online for free soda pdf. The analysis of asynchronous sequential circuits proceeds in much the same way as that of clocked synchronous sequential circuits. Block diagram flip flop flip flop is a sequential circuit which generally samples its inputs and changes its outputs only at. Combinational circuits are defined as the time independent circuits which do not depends upon previous inputs to generate any output are termed as combinational circuits.
Sequential circuits pjf synchronous sequential circuits. State reduction and minimization similar to synchronous sequential circuit design, in asynchronous design we might obtain a large flow table. Combinational logic a combinational system device is a digital system in which the value of the output at any instant depends only on the value of the input at that same instant and not on previous values. Give a precise definition of synchronous sequential circuits. Asynchronous sequential circuits an example of a flowtable can be seen below, for the system of four states with one input this table is called a primitive flow table because it has only one stable state in each row. Sequential circuit design university of pittsburgh. Yet virtually all useful systems require storage of. Difference between synchronous and asynchronous sequential. This free online tool allows to combine multiple pdf or image files into a single pdf document. Sequential is an american synthesizer company founded in 1974 as sequential circuits by dave smith. Synchronous where flipflops are used to implement the states, and a clock signal is used to control the operation. Consequently the output is solely a function of the current inputs. Sequential circuits the digital circuits we have seen so far gates, multiplexer, demultiplexer, encoders, decoders are combinatorial in nature, i.
Sequential logic circuits can be constructed to produce either simple edgetriggered flipflops or more complex sequential circuits such as storage registers, shift registers, memory devices or counters. Flip flop is a sequential circuit which generally samples its inputs and changes its outputs only at particular instants of time and not continuously. Bistable latches and flipflops are the basic building blocks of sequential logic circuits. A circuit with two crosscoupled nor gates or two crosscoupled nand gates. Asynchronous sequential circuits resemble combinatorial circuits with feedback paths. We now consider the analysis and design of sequential circuits. Aug 11, 2018 combinational circuits are defined as the time independent circuits which do not depends upon previous inputs to generate any output are termed as combinational circuits. Binary counters simple design b bits can count from 0 to 2b. Combine pdfs in the order you want with the easiest pdf merger available. The sequential circuits proone annotated manual annotations in bold square brackets by jet. Since all the circuit action will take place under the control of. Soda pdf merge tool allows you to combine two or more documents into a single pdf file for free. Sequential circuits consist of a combinational circuit to which storage elements are connected to form a feedback path specified by a time sequence of inputs, outputs, and internal states two types of sequential circuits. Changes in input variables cause changes in states.
In synchronous circuits clock was responsible for the transfer of state from the present state to the next state. Sequential this course synchronous sequential circuits. The clock pulses are distributed throughout the system. Sequential circuits outputs depend on present inputs and previous inputs also it contains memory elements for storing previous state inputs examples of sequential circuits are flip flops, counters, shift registers 4. All state elements are connected to the same clock signal the state of the entire circuit is updated at the same time. Avoid to use latches as possible in synchronous sequential circuits to avoid design problems 58 sr latch. Easy to build using jk flipflops use the jk 11 to toggle. Digital electronics part i combinational and sequential. How to design sequential circuit using pla programmable. Based on the clock input, it is further classified into synchrous circuits and asynchronous circuits. Flip flops as state memory sequential circuits pjf the flipflops receive their inputs from the combinational circuit and also from a clock signal with pulses that occur at fixed intervals of time, as shown in the timing diagram. A discussion of the construction of stateoutput tables or diagrams from a word description or flow chart specification of sequential behavior. Synchronous sequential circuits a synchronous sequential circuits is one in which the contents of the memory can change only at discrete instants time or on the of transitions of a clock. Sequential logic circuits unlike combinational logic circuits, the output of sequential logic circuits not only depends on current inputs but also on the past sequence of inputs.
Sequential circuits are constructed using combinational logic and a number of memory elements with some or all of the. No internet usage to merge so very secure and fast continuous update, new features pdf merge sequence arrangement you can merge. In the example of the dg sequential circuit, the maximal compatibles are. They do not remember the history of past inputs and, therefore, do not require any memory elements. The basic circuits from which all flipflops are constructed. Sequential circuits use current input variables and previous input variables by storeing the information and putting back into the circuit on the next clock activation cycle. Synchronous vs asynchronous sequential circuit sequential. Here, a detailed comparison of synchronous sequential circuits and asynchronous sequential circuits is presented. Sequential circuit is one of the major categories of digital logic circuits. Packaging refers to the proper organization of the stuff you hand in, following the guidelines for deliverables above. The figure above shows a theoretical view of how sequential circuits are made up from combinational logic and some storage elements. The fundamental property of a sequential circuit is that the output is a function of input as well as states.
Analysis of clocked synchronous sequential circuits. What are sequential circuits and combinational circuits. Concept of memory is obtained via unclocked latches andor circuit delay. Quickly merge multiple pdf files or part of them into a single one. Combinational logic and sequential logic are the building blocks of digital system design. The sequential circuits are designed by various methods like by using roms and flips, plas, cplds complex programmable logic device, fpgas field programmable gate array.
Synchronous asynchronous primary difference 94 synchronous vs. Jan 12, 2019 in this tutorial, we will learn about sequential circuits, what is sequential logic, how are sequential circuits different from combinational circuits, different types of sequential circuits, a few important sequential circuits basics and many more. In this article, we are going to discuss only on how to design a sequential circuit using plas. These digital logic circuits can be classified into two categories such as combinational logic circuits and sequential logic circuits. Not practical for use in synchronous sequential circuits. Merger diagrams states are represented as dot in a circle lines connect states couples compatible maximal sets can be identified as those sets in which every states is. For a given input combination, a sequential circuit may produce different. A familiar example of a device with sequential logic is a television set with channel up and channel down buttons. Kennings page 1 analysis of clocked synchronous sequential circuits now that we have flipflops and the concept of memory in our circuit, we might want to determine what a circuit is doing. In sequential circuits, the state of the circuit is crucial in determining the output values.
Analysis procedure asynchronous sequential circuits. What are digital logic circuits with their differences. Flip flop is a sequential circuit which generally samples its inputs and changes its outputs only. The basic problem is that how the past history can be captured. Later, we will study circuits having a stored internal state, i. In sequential circuits, the \state of the circuit is crucial in determining the output values. Elec 326 1 sequential circuit timing sequential circuit timing objectives this section covers several timing considerations encountered in the design of synchronous sequential circuits. Before studying about the difference between combinational and sequential logic circuits, primarily, we must know what is combinational logic circuit and what are sequential logic circuits. Circuits with flipflop sequential circuit circuit state. Digital integrated circuits sequential logic prentice hall 1995 sequential logic. Begin manual begin manual begin manual title page model 100 sn 1 and up. Asynchronous sequential circuits type of circuit without clocks, but with the concept of memory. Like the synchronous sequential circuits we have studied up to this point they are realized by adding state feedback to combinational logic that implements a nextstate function.
722 126 1076 929 818 1274 106 597 1258 506 828 894 129 543 1406 82 559 921 598 626 931 295 182 1020 328 649 561 1327 368 803 1414 1320 827 461 1153 72 991 1450 332 253 365 212 149 1037 1499 1382 973 501 967 165